Циклы

Тема в разделе "C/C++/C#", создана пользователем -, 24 сен 2011.

  1. Гость

    Подскажите как сделать, чтобы при каждом вводе В формула вычислялась 10 раз
    Код (Text):
    #include "stdafx.h"
    #include <conio.h>
    #include <math.h>
    #include <iostream>
    using namespace std;
    int main()
    {
    double P=3.14;
    double  A, B;
    cout << "B=";
    cin >> B;

    for (int i=1; i<=10; i++)
    {
    A=sqrt(2.0)*B/(2*P);
    }
    cout << "A=" <<A;
    getch();
    return 0;
    }
     
  2. lazybiz

    lazybiz Well-Known Member
    C\C++ Team

    Регистрация:
    3 ноя 2010
    Сообщения:
    1.344
    Симпатии:
    0
    Она у тебя ровно 10 раз и вычисляется. Или тебе надо B бесконечно вводить?
     
  3. VadikV

    VadikV Member

    Регистрация:
    10 ноя 2010
    Сообщения:
    17
    Симпатии:
    0
    прикольно. а какой смысл вычислять эут формулу 10 раз? ведь в ней при каждой итерации ничего не меняется....
     
  4. Гость

    Нет. Надо 10 раз ввести B и чтобы 10 ответов получилось.
     
  5. lazybiz

    lazybiz Well-Known Member
    C\C++ Team

    Регистрация:
    3 ноя 2010
    Сообщения:
    1.344
    Симпатии:
    0
    Ну так перенеси ввод B и вывод A в цикл. В чем проблема?
     
Загрузка...
Похожие Темы - Циклы
  1. Maddy101d
    Ответов:
    3
    Просмотров:
    1.015
  2. Homka
    Ответов:
    12
    Просмотров:
    2.880
  3. Smile1995
    Ответов:
    2
    Просмотров:
    1.135
  4. Antonim
    Ответов:
    2
    Просмотров:
    1.473

Поделиться этой страницей